Buying Guide: Key Considerations When Choosing Vintage-Style Bed Sheets
Fabric type: Natural fibers like cotton offer breathability and durability, while microfiber provides softness and wrinkle resistance. Percale weave gives a crisp feel; sateen offers a smoother, more lustrous surface. Choose based on climate and personal texture preference.
Thread count and durability: Higher thread counts often correlate with softness and longevity, but the weave and fiber quality matter more. 200–600 TC is common for cotton percale or sateen, while microfiber relies on fiber density rather than TC.
Fit and pockets: Deep-pocket fitted sheets (up to 16 inches or more) suit taller mattresses or toppers. Look for 360° elastic and all-around grip to prevent sheet shift during sleep, especially for restless night sleepers.
Prints and colors: Vintage-inspired prints range from cottage florals to boho botanicals. Consider room decor, wall colors, and existing furniture to ensure the pattern complements the space rather than clashing.
Care and maintenance: Reactive dyeing improves colorfastness; some fabrics require specific washing instructions to maintain prints and fabric integrity. Check washing guidelines to minimize fading or pilling over time.
Maintenance and care: If you prioritize easy care, microfiber options tend to resist wrinkles and simplify washing, though cotton options deliver a more traditional feel and longer lifespan when cared for properly.
